With good maintenance (balancing every 6 months, rototing frequently, running proper pressure) you can expect around 20k-30k out of those. I ran 3 sets of supers swamper LTB's before. First set died too early, too much pressure. Second set i ran at 20/18 psi F/R and they lated 24k. 3rd set i sold before i wore em down.
